Toyota Forklift Indicator Lights: 7+ Common Issues

Illumination-based alerts on these material handling vehicles provide operators with immediate feedback regarding system status and potential malfunctions. These visual signals, often a combination of colors and symbols, communicate critical information about operational parameters like engine temperature, oil pressure, battery charge, and safety interlocks. For example, a blinking red light might indicate a critical system failure requiring immediate attention, while a steady green light may signal normal operating conditions.

The value of these alert mechanisms lies in their ability to prevent equipment damage, enhance operator safety, and minimize downtime. By providing readily accessible information, operators can quickly identify and address potential issues before they escalate into more serious problems. Historically, these visual cues have evolved from simple warning lights to sophisticated systems integrated with onboard diagnostics, enabling more precise fault identification and reporting.

9+ Toyota Camry Dashboard Lights: What They Mean!

Illuminated symbols on the instrument panel of a Toyota Camry convey vital information about the vehicle’s operational status and potential malfunctions. These visual alerts, employing a standardized color-coding system, alert the driver to immediate concerns or indicate the activation of specific vehicle systems. For example, an illuminated engine icon in yellow or red signifies a potential engine problem requiring diagnostic attention, while a green indicator might confirm the correct operation of cruise control.

Understanding these notifications is crucial for preventative maintenance and ensuring safe vehicle operation. Interpreting these symbols accurately allows for the timely resolution of minor issues before they escalate into major, costly repairs. Historically, reliance on these indicators has increased as vehicle systems become more complex, providing a readily accessible means for drivers to stay informed about their vehicle’s condition, thereby promoting vehicle longevity and driver safety.

Best Starrett Last Word Indicators & Comparisons

The Starrett No. 711 Last Word dial test indicator is a precision measuring instrument widely used in machining, toolmaking, and inspection applications. This compact device typically attaches to a magnetic base or stand and uses a sensitive lever mechanism connected to a dial gauge. The gauge amplifies small movements of the contact point, allowing for precise measurement of variations in surface height, depth, or other dimensional deviations. For example, it’s invaluable for ensuring the accurate alignment of a milling machine vise or checking the runout of a rotating shaft.

Known for its durability and reliability, this iconic tool has been a mainstay in workshops for decades. Its compact design, sensitive mechanism, and ease of use contribute to its enduring popularity among professionals. Precise measurements are crucial for maintaining tight tolerances and ensuring the quality and interchangeability of parts, making this type of instrument essential in various industrial processes. Its historical presence in the industry underscores its effectiveness and lasting value.

9+ Conclusion Indicator Words: Guide & Examples

Certain terms signal the closing of an argument or the summarization of key points. These terms, such as “therefore,” “in summary,” “finally,” “thus,” and “in conclusion,” often precede a restatement of the main idea or a synthesis of the supporting evidence. For example, a concluding sentence might read, “Thus, the available data supports the hypothesis.”

Utilizing such terms benefits both the writer and the reader. For the writer, these terms provide a clear and concise way to signal the end of their line of reasoning. They allow for a distinct separation between the supporting arguments and the final takeaway. For the reader, these signals provide a roadmap, indicating the arrival at the main point and aiding in comprehension and retention. This practice has a long history in rhetoric and composition, reflecting a core principle of effective communication: clear organization leads to better understanding.
